5-minute granola
yield: 2 portions
ingredients
- 1/4 cup chopped pecans and pistachios (or your choice of nuts)
- 1/4 cup unsweetened dehydrated coconut flakes
- 1/4 rolled oats
- 1 tablespoon maple syrup
procedure
- In a dry skillet over medium heat, toast nuts, coconut and oats. Stir constantly until golden and fragrant, about 3 minutes.
- Remove mixture to a bowl. Add maple syrup and stir until everything is coated. Allow to cool until mixture starts to clump together, about 2 minutes.
- Serve over yogurt.
